Choosing the Right Keyboard

Selecting a keyboard that complements your Wacom Cintiq 16 setup involves considering comfort, connectivity, and programmability. Mechanical keyboards with customizable keys are popular among artists for their tactile feedback and durability.

  • Mechanical Keyboards: Offer tactile feedback and durability.
  • Wireless Options: Reduce clutter and increase flexibility.
  • Programmable Keys: Enable shortcuts for common functions like undo, redo, zoom, and layer adjustments.

Selecting a Stylus for Precision

The stylus is your primary tool for creating detailed artwork on the Wacom Cintiq 16. Choosing a stylus with high sensitivity, pressure levels, and tilt recognition enhances your control and artistic expression.

  • Pressure Sensitivity: Look for styluses with at least 2048 levels for nuanced strokes.
  • Tilt Recognition: Allows for shading and dynamic brush effects.
  • Battery Life: Consider styluses with long-lasting batteries or passive styluses that do not require charging.
  • Compatibility: Ensure the stylus is compatible with Wacom devices.

Setting Up Your Workspace

Arrange your keyboard within easy reach of your Wacom Cintiq 16 to facilitate quick access to shortcuts. Position your stylus holder nearby for convenience during long creative sessions. Proper ergonomic setup can help prevent strain and improve your workflow.

Additional Tips for Optimization

Consider using a stand or adjustable arm for your Wacom Cintiq 16 to find the most comfortable drawing angle. Use keyboard shortcuts actively to speed up your process and keep your creative flow uninterrupted. Regularly calibrate your stylus to maintain precision and responsiveness.
